Biography
Cassiano Carneiro (Rio de Janeiro, May 11, 1973) is a Brazilian actor. He became known for starring in the biopic Quem Matou Pixote? (1996) and, later, for his performances in soap operas. Carneiro is the winner of several awards, including an APCA and the Best Actor awards at the Gramado Festival and the Havana Festival, in addition to being nominated for a Guarani Film Award.
